Output 15c279a53176b8e6921d3fa8f75c288501518ac7b19c3107b6cfe56c7590ba00:1

value
6405609966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0422ddc4f44b8984bed25deb96c3ad0a28352dc5 OP_EQUAL
address
324tPs1qU4g7YhGmYNhXjznc3NmqHnBkFg
transaction
15c279a53176b8e6921d3fa8f75c288501518ac7b19c3107b6cfe56c7590ba00
confirmations
171336
spent
true